When the Bronco is pretty dirty, I find it really difficult to get a good clean of the paint behind the spare. Any tips for getting behind there and getting that paint nice and clean and being able to apply some wax? It might come down to just pulling the spare.

^^^ this. You can get a wash mitt behind there fairly easily but yes it’s hard to thoroughly clean and dry well. I do a light polish and sealant back there when I take the tire off for rotation every 5k miles.

You could use a long microfiber wheel brush, such as a "wheel woolie" or "woolywormit" (there are also similar generic ones for less than 10 dollars). It won't help you with the waxing, though.
